Tekken 7 Brings the Pain This June

Bandai Namco has finally announced the release date for the latest addition to the critically acclaimed Tekken franchise, Tekken 7. Set to launch for the PS4, Xbox One, and PC on June 2nd, Tekken 7 will have a Collector’s Edition, a Digital Deluxe version, and a number of pre-order bonuses and DLC packs.

The Collector’s Edition of Tekken 7 will include the game, a 12” tall by 18” wide statue of Kazuya fighting Heihachi mid-air, a special Steelbook, and the game’s official soundtrack.

The Deluxe Edition will include the game and the Season Pass, which will give players three content packs set to include new playable characters, new stages, a new game mode, costume packs, and a bonus 35-piece Metallic Costume Pack.

Players who pre-order will receive Eliza as a playable character, while Xbox One players will also receive a free digital copy of Tekken 6 through backwards compatibility. Playstation owners will have exclusive access to legacy costumes for King, Xiaoyu and Jin from Tekken 2 and Tekken 4, as well as an exclusive jukebox mode that lets players listen to and fight to tracks from throughout the Tekken series.
